...
以太坊作为一种广泛使用的区块链平台,支持智能合约和去中心化应用。用户在进行以太坊交易时,经常会遇到“交易状态一直打包中”的问题。这种情况使得用户的资产在交易未确认期间无法使用,引发诸多困扰。本文将详细探讨以太坊钱包交易一直打包中的原因及其解决方案,为用户提供实用的指导,帮助他们更好地处理相关问题。
### 以太坊交易打包过程解析要理解以太坊交易为何会一直处于打包中,首先需要了解以太坊网络的基础架构。
在以太坊网络中,所有的交易都需要由矿工打包进区块,才能在区块链上被确认。这里的“打包”是指矿工将交易整理成区块,并通过工作量证明的机制进行验证。每个区块有特定的大小和生成时间,意味着冲突的交易需要排队等待。
以太坊的每笔交易都需要支付一定的“燃气费用”,以激励矿工处理这些交易。燃气费用越高,交易被打包的速度通常越快。然而,在网络繁忙时,许多用户的交易可能因为费用设置过低而长时间处于待处理状态,因此“打包中”的现象频繁出现。
### 导致交易一直打包中的常见原因 #### 网络拥堵网络拥堵是最常见的原因之一。当大量用户同时进行交易时,区块链的处理能力可能会达到极限,导致新的交易排队等待。这种情况通常发生在关键时刻,例如新币发行或重大新闻事件时,用户的需求会瞬间激增。
#### 交易费用设置过低用户在发起交易时,往往会对“燃气价格”进行设置。如果用户选择的燃气费低于当前市场水平,交易将会被矿工优先忽略,从而一直处于打包中。
#### 节点问题以太坊网络由数千个节点构成,任何一个节点的故障都可能影响到交易的确认。如果用户的钱包节点遭遇技术问题,交易可能无法被及时广播和确认。
#### 钱包软件问题有时,钱包软件本身也可能导致问题。如果用户使用的应用存在bug或不兼容情况,可能会造成交易信息发送失败,导致状态永远处于打包中。
### 如何检查和确认交易状态 #### 使用区块链浏览器查询交易最简单的方法是使用区块链浏览器,如Etherscan。在输入交易哈希后,可以快速查看交易状态,包括确认数量、区块高度等信息。
#### 查看交易状态的不同标志交易有多种状态:待处理、已确认、失败等。用户需要了解这些状态的具体含义,以便正确识别交易的当前状态。
#### 了解确认的数量和影响在Ethereum网络中,每个交易需要得到一定数量的确认才能被视为有效。通常情况下,6个确认被认为是安全的。因此,对于挂起的交易,用户需要监控确认数量的变化。
### 解决以太坊交易一直打包中的方法 #### 提升交易费用最直接的解决方案是提高交易的燃气费。用户可以使用钱包的“替换交易”功能来重新发送交易,增加燃气价格,以吸引矿工优先打包。
#### 重新广播交易用户可以通过手动重新广播未确认的交易来尝试触发确认。这一过程需要输入交易哈希在找回工具中进行操作,或求助于区块链社区。
#### 使用交易加速器许多在线工具提供交易加速服务,通过向矿工支付更多的费用,让交易尽快被处理。用户可以根据自己的需求选择合适的加速器。
#### 清理和重启钱包在某些情况下,钱包软件的重启或数据清理可能有助于解决打包中问题。用户可以备份现有数据,然后重启钱包,以恢复正常功能。
### 预防措施,避免未来问题 #### 理解当前网络拥堵情况在进行重要交易前,用户应了解当前网络的状态,如拥堵程度、矿工活动等。可以通过访问一些数据分析网站快速获得此信息,这样可以选择一个最佳的时间进行交易。
#### 确定合理的交易费用用户可以参考当前市场上的燃气价格指导,设置个人交易的燃气费用相应的金额,确保能够尽快被打包。
#### 选择合适的钱包软件一个稳定、安全且良好的钱包软件能够降低交易过程中出现问题的概率。用户应根据他人的评价及性能选择合适的钱包。
### 结语以太坊交易卡在打包中的现象并不罕见,通过理解其背后的原因及相应解决方案,用户能够有效应对。掌握相关的知识也能够提升用户在未来进行交易的体验,减少潜在的资金风险。希望本文能够为你提供实用的帮助。如果深入了解更多以太坊及区块链的知识,可以参考官方文档和社区论坛。
--- ## 相关问题 1. **以太坊交易费如何计算?** 2. **在以太坊中,交易状态的不同标志代表什么?** 3. **如何使用区块链浏览器有效查询交易状态?** 4. **选择以太坊钱包时该注意哪些方面?** 5. **交易卡在打包中会对用户的资产造成哪些影响?** 6. **区块链的工作原理如何保证交易的安全性?** 7. **未来以太坊协议中可能有哪些改进,如何影响交易速度?** --- 接下来,可以根据每个问题详细展开,每个问题不少于700字。请告知我是否继续!